1. What is the main reason for using a moisture barrier under hardwood
flooring?
A. Increase flooring height
B. Prevent moisture from damaging wood
C. Improve insulation
D. Enhance soundproofing
Rationale: Moisture barriers are essential to prevent water vapor from
damaging wood, which can cause warping and mold.
2. Which tool is commonly used to stretch carpet during installation?
A. Circular saw
B. Floor roller
C. Power stretcher
D. Jamb saw
Rationale: A power stretcher ensures the carpet is tight and properly
secured to avoid wrinkles and trip hazards.
,3. What is the purpose of acclimating wood flooring before installation?
A. To clean the wood
B. To dry the wood faster
C. To allow the wood to adjust to room temperature and humidity
D. To apply sealant
Rationale: Acclimation prevents future expansion or contraction that could
damage the flooring.
4. What is the minimum temperature recommended for installing vinyl
flooring?
A. 32°F
B. 45°F
C. 65°F
D. 80°F
Rationale: Most vinyl flooring manufacturers recommend a minimum
temperature of 65°F to ensure proper adhesion and flexibility.
5. Which type of flooring is most sensitive to subfloor moisture?
A. Ceramic tile
B. Solid hardwood
C. Laminate
D. Carpet
Rationale: Solid hardwood is more likely to expand or contract when
exposed to moisture compared to other flooring types.
6. What is the correct method to check a concrete slab for moisture
content?
A. Sprinkle water and observe absorption
B. Use a thermometer
C. Use a calcium chloride test or a moisture meter
D. Knock and listen for sound
, Rationale: Industry-standard moisture tests like calcium chloride or
moisture meters give accurate results for flooring suitability.
7. Which fastener is typically used in nail-down hardwood flooring
installations?
A. Roofing nails
B. Concrete screws
C. Flooring cleats or staples
D. Brad nails
Rationale: Flooring cleats or staples are designed specifically for holding
hardwood flooring in place.
8. What is the purpose of a transition strip in flooring?
A. Aesthetic design only
B. To provide a smooth transition between different flooring types
C. To hide damage
D. To increase slip resistance
Rationale: Transition strips bridge height differences and provide safety
and aesthetic consistency.
9. When preparing a subfloor for laminate flooring, the surface should be:
A. Slightly uneven
B. Clean, dry, and level
C. Damped and sanded
D. Covered with carpet pad
Rationale: A level, dry subfloor is necessary to avoid gaps, creaks, or
premature wear in laminate flooring.
